Abstract :The aim of the study is to investigate the impact of placement test, pop-quizzes and portfolio assessment on class attendance and language achievement. The study also encompasses gender and faculty as other independent variables that affect the students’ class attendance and language achievement. The data gathered from a total of 307 students studying English in the elective preparatory class of a state university in Turkey are analysed through SPSS 25. In the study, descriptive and inferential statistics are implemented. Descriptive analyses such as frequency and percentage are applied in order to reveal information about participants. Independent Sample t-tests, one-way ANOVA, post hoc tests and regression analyses are also performed to determine the relationship between dependent and independent variables. The findings in the study show that portfolio tasks are the most important factors for students’ class attendance and language achievement, which demonstrates that authentic assessment is an important factor. It is found that males do not attend the classes more than females but females are more successful than males. In addition, the faculty as another independent variable does not have a significant effect on class attendance but engineering faculty has a significant impact on language achievement rather than economics faculty.Keywords : Placement test, pop quizzes, portfolio assessment, class attendance, language achievement
